Output 25fa7c653ca8bf55746268b6e084da2fd4873d19e0b0ab2d9c8cd7fca8d0168a:0

value
166159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8870135c983e8f9593dd4ac467980cdd073f383c OP_EQUAL
address
3E8S5nRwwQF1aDSXaU9A1erGMsVRufHwQu
transaction
25fa7c653ca8bf55746268b6e084da2fd4873d19e0b0ab2d9c8cd7fca8d0168a
confirmations
25291
spent
true